Lieberman Jumps In

Connecticut Senator Joseph Lieberman has entered the race for the 2004 Presidential election. So is America ready for its first Jewish president? Only time will tell. As Al Gore’s running mate in 2000, they did get more votes than any Democratic ticket in the history of the United States. To be exact, a half million more.
